Product features
Wi-Fi 6 Performance
HPE Aruba Networking 500 Series Campus Access Points deliver a maximum combined data rate of 1.49 Gbps with 2 spatial streams to meet the needs of low and medium density environments. Wi-Fi CERTIFIED with support for Wi-Fi 6 features such as OFDMA, bidirectional MU-MIMO, and target wait time (TWT) to drive improved efficiency. Handles multiple Wi-Fi 6 capable clients on each channel simultaneously, regardless of device or traffic type. Enhanced wireless experience with HPE Aruba Networking ClientMatch technology that removes sticky client issues by steering a client to the access point where it receives the best radio signal.Cloud Management and Ready for IoT
HPE Aruba Networking 500 Series Campus Access Points can managed with HPE Aruba Networking Central, an AI-powered solution that simplifies IT operations, improves agility, and reduces costs by unifying management of campus, branch, remote, data center, and IoT networks from one dashboard. Supports Bluetooth 5 and Zigbee wireless protocols through an integrated IoT radio, and third-party expansion with an integrated USB port. HPE Aruba Networking Central Client Insights uses deep packet inspection to provide additional context and behavioral information that help verify devices are receiving proper policy enforcement and continuously monitor for rogue devices.Simple and Secure Access
HPE Aruba Networking 500 Series Campus Access Points offer enhanced security with Dynamic Segmentation to remove the time-consuming and error-prone task of managing complex and static VLANs, ACLs, and subnets by dynamically assigning policies and keeping traffic protected and separated. Offers stronger encryption and authentication with WPA3, protected credentials/keys storage for guest access with Enhanced Open, and user and IoT access policy enforcement firewalls (PEF). WPA3 and Enhanced Open security increases enterprise-level security by providing stronger guest access protections without increasing complexity. For enhanced device assurance, the access points include an installed Trusted Platform Module (TPM) for protected storage of credentials and keys, and boot code.Key selling points
